A ''Baby iPod'' That Plays Music In Mother’s Womb

The contoured belt called a B (l) aby with a built-in beatles is the brainchild of Geof Ramsay. A series of special "speakers" in this instrument transmit vibrations from the music to the foetus. There is another feature that comes as an additional bonus for the expectant mothers. Three tiny mechanisms in the back of the belt provide the mother-to-be with a relaxing massage.
The designer student, Geof Ramsay created this baby iPod out of the centuries old theory of music being a catalyst for an unborn child's mental growth. This simple device gives mothers a chance to try out that theory. Even though classical music is what the experts have suggested to be used, the expectant mothers can also play their favourite Beatles track or even Led Zeppelin.
